CS/HB 1991: Trauma Services

GENERAL BILL by Governmental Rules & Regulations ; Casey ; (CO-INTRODUCERS) Fasano

Trauma Services; revises minimum components for local & regional trauma services system plans; provides for statewide inclusive trauma system; revises requirements re trauma transport protocols; revises requirements re trauma scoring system & rules re thereto; provides procedures prior to interfacility trauma transfer to ensure patient care & safety, etc. Creates 395.4001; amends Ch. 395, 322.0602, 440.13.

Effective Date: 10/01/2000 except as otherwise provided
Last Action: 6/2/2000 - Approved by Governor; Chapter No. 2000-189
